The Winners and Losers in Oil Price Increases
Find Out Who Comes Out on Top When Price Increases Are Handed Down In the wake of price increases on finished lubricants, it’s important to understand not only the causes of those increases but also who the true winners and losers are when they occur. About 80% of domestic oil... Read More +